AOC 2028: could she be the first female US president? – podcast

Football Weekly | The Guardian

Leftwing Democrats are having their moment in the sun, with Zohran Mamdani in New York, Abdul El-Sayed in Michigan and endless calls for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ez to run for president in 2028. Has Democratic socialism shifted from the political fringe to the mainstream? And can this group lure back the all-important swing voters?

Jonathan Freedland speaks to Bhaskar Sunkara, president of the Nation magazine, founding editor of Jacobin and author of The Socialist Manifesto: The Case for Radical Politics in an Era of Extreme Inequalities
